Output 990575161533e57e52cbe30470afb9925c3ba8e7e45c6c3913b7c27948047909:0

value
57322244
script pubkey
OP_0 OP_PUSHBYTES_20 3623d1d5ae3a9c279452608356bbd80b2afd7752
address
ltc1qxc3ar4dw82wz09zjvzp4dw7cpv406a6jz6vq9w
transaction
990575161533e57e52cbe30470afb9925c3ba8e7e45c6c3913b7c27948047909
spent
true